G6 Hospitality Group Hotels Near Office World

Motel 6 Harbor City, CA - Los Angeles

Motel 6 Harbor City, CA - Los Angeles

3.8 / 5
820 Sepulveda Blvd
3.39KM from Office World
per night
From
USD**0